"11 years to get it wrong"

About: University Hospital Of North Tees / Trauma and orthopaedics

Following hip replacement surgery in 2007 I have been a regular visitor to North Tees and Hartlepool hospitals for numerous scans,x rays, injections and consultations with staff of the Orthopaedic and Spinal units.

I have been seen to be at the limit of what can be done for me in the Orthopaedic unit, passed to the Spinal unit, who now have reached their limit also, and so have suggested to my GP that I should now attend a pain management clinic.

BE AWARE. The new Pain Management Triage system done for the NHS after is done by a private management service who decide which treatment programme is suitable. The clinician for this service was a physiotherapist, not a doctor.

His diagnosis on how I should manage my pain was to train my brain to ignore the pain, and to attend group forums with other pain sufferers so that we could all discuss each others levels of pain.

He stated he was not qualified to administer drugs or medical services.So, after a 12 week wait to see someone I thought was competent to review my pain medication, I am no better whatsoever, a complete waste of time.

Obviously an NHS cost cutting ploy.

So, 11 years later,be warned,a new hip can sometimes lead to a great deal of suffering,

CHOOSE YOUR SURGEON WITH CARE
